数据库开发入门与实践:从HelloWorld到HSQLDB

需积分: 9 2 下载量 113 浏览量 更新于2024-08-02 收藏 5.63MB DOC 举报
"编程数据库的内幕在网上找的感觉不错" 这篇资料主要涵盖了数据库开发的基础知识,适合初学者入门。它从搭建开发环境开始,逐步引导读者理解并掌握编程和数据库的相关技能。 1. 开发环境搭建 - **Java运行环境JRE**:Java运行环境是进行Java开发的基础,JRE提供了运行Java程序所需的类库和虚拟机。 - **Web服务器**:解释了什么是服务,Web服务器用于托管应用程序,如Apache Tomcat,它能解析HTTP请求并返回响应。 - **HoCAT使用简介**:可能指的是集成开发环境,如Eclipse或IntelliJ IDEA,它们是开发Java和Web应用的重要工具。 - **Eclipse使用简介**:Eclipse是一个强大的开源集成开发环境,支持多种编程语言,包括Java,提供了代码编辑、调试、构建等功能。 - **新建项目**:介绍了如何在Eclipse中创建新项目,包括Java项目和Tomcat项目。 2. 思维导图与学习方法 - **思维导图**:使用FreeMind等工具来梳理思路,帮助组织和可视化信息,提高学习效率。 - **Google搜索技巧**:强调快速查找知识的重要性,学会有效地利用搜索引擎获取信息。 - **形象思维能力**:鼓励培养形象思维,以提高理解和记忆能力。 3. 编程基础 - **HelloWorld范例**:通过简单的输出练习,帮助初学者熟悉编程环境和基本语法。 - **数据类型**:讲解了计算机数据类型的概念,如整型、浮点型、字符型等,并介绍了常量和变量的定义。 - **运算符**:涵盖了算术、比较、条件、逻辑和位运算,这些都是编程中的基本操作。 4. 数据库基础 - **数据操作种类**:包括插入、更新、删除和查询等基本操作。 - **数据库模型**:介绍了常见的数据库模型,如关系型数据库模型。 - **资源申请与释放**:在数据库操作中,正确地打开和关闭连接是非常重要的,这涉及到资源管理。 - **SQL语句**:强调了一个简单的SQL语句就能解决复杂问题,强调了数据库编程的简洁性。 5. 商业与个人发展 - **商业计划书**:讨论了商业计划书的重要性,它有助于规划项目和业务的发展方向。 - **资源整合**:提倡自我驱动和主动学习,认为成功不仅在于个人努力,也在于有效利用资源。 6. 开源数据库HSQLDB - **HSQLDB运行模式**:介绍了HSQLDB的不同运行方式,可能包括内嵌式和服务器模式。 - **HSQLDB基本概念**:涵盖了HSQLDB的关键特性,它是一个轻量级的关系型数据库,常用于测试和小型应用。 整个资料旨在帮助初学者建立起编程和数据库开发的坚实基础,通过实例和实践指导,使学习者能够逐步掌握相关技能。同时,它还融入了一些生活哲学和职业建议,强调自我驱动和持续学习的重要性。